Things to do near Queens Park

Queens Park in Bournemouth offers a delightful range of activities to enjoy, including golf for enthusiasts, various entertainment options for families, and swimming opportunities to cool off during warmer days. This vibrant area is perfect for those looking to engage in leisure activities while surrounded by picturesque scenery.

Shopping

In Queens Park, visit Castle Point Shopping Centre, just 621m away, for a vibrant shopping experience with various stores. If you're up for a drive, New Forest Cider, located 5.0km away, offers unique local products, while WestQuay Shopping Centre, 14.3km away, boasts an extensive selection of shops.

Recreation

Vitality Stadium, located 373m from Queens Park, offers an energetic atmosphere for sports enthusiasts. For a more tranquil experience, visit Coastal Activity Park, 1.6km away, where you can unwind amidst nature. Additionally, Meyrick Park Golf Course, 1.2km from Queens Park, provides a delightful outdoor golfing experience.

Adventure

Experience the thrills at Altitude High Ropes Adventure, located 621m from Queens Park, where you can conquer ziplines amidst stunning outdoor scenery. For a splashing good time, Splashdown Waterpark, situated 2.5km away, offers exhilarating water rides perfect for the whole family.

Nightlife

In Queens Park, Bournemouth, the nightlife is vibrant with options like the Bournemouth Pavilion Theatre, showcasing culture and entertainment, and O2 Academy Bournemouth, known for its lively shows. For some family adventure, don't miss Laser Quest Bournemouth, perfect for an exciting night out.

Best time to go to Queens Park

The best time to visit Queens Park can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ature around Queens Park falls in July and August. August has moderately high visitor numbers and mostly sunny weather. The coolest average temperature around Queens Park falls in January, visitor numbers are moderately low and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.
